The Robert J. & Nancy D. Carney Institute for Brain Science is committed to supporting research and facilitating collaborations in brain science across the Brown University community and beyond. Our mission is to promote discovery and innovation in brain science by supporting a diverse community of experimentalists, theorists, engineers, and clinical scientists. We do this by recruiting and retaining world-class faculty, creating an outstanding collaborative training environment, seeding innovative projects, supporting collaborative teams, and raising the visibility and reputation of Carney researchers.

The Associate Director in the Carney Institute for Brain Science provides oversight for all aspects of finance and administration of the Institute. The incumbent has expertise in university administration to increase the research impact and profile of the Institute by overseeing:

  • Financial administration, by managing institutional, endowed, and gift
    funds; serving as Carney lead in the university budgeting process working
    with central finance team; overseeing annual submission and approval of
    core facility user fees;
  • Research administration, by leading the management of pre- and post-
    award activities in Carney, overseeing pre- and post-award staff; and
    ensuring responsible and compliant financial management of awards;
  • Faculty affairs, by ensuring all Carney faculty recruitments are conducted
    effectively and responsibly; faculty salary commitments and offsets are
    reviewed regularly and changes anticipated; Carney faculty and their
    appointments are reviewed regularly in accordance with University
    policies and Carney Institute Standards and Criteria;
  • Human resources, by overseeing staff hiring and managing a team of
    administrators, serving as HR point of contact for the Institute and
    supporting teams;
  • Operations and administrative support, by overseeing daily operations
    of the center, including daily management of Carney staff.

The Associate Director directly supervises teams of staff administrators in the areas of finance, research administration, and administrative support. This position reports to the Director of the Institute.

Qualifications

  • Master’s degree in business, higher education administration, or science
    discipline or equivalent combination of experience and education.
  • 5+ years of experience and increasing levels of responsibility in academic
    administration, particularly in finance and sponsored research operations
  • Familiarity with federal and foundation funding mechanisms
  • Familiarity with faculty affairs
  • Managerial and organizational experience
  • Ability to work in a complex environment that requires communicating with administration, faculty, staff and students.
  • Outstanding written and verbal communication skills
  • Willingness and ability to support a diverse and inclusive campus community
